Ruby On The Beach: Cooperative Learning in Tropical Surroundings
(Up)Nestled in Bali's scenic landscape, Ruby On The Beach delivers a unique cooperative learning experience for aspiring developers seeking both technical growth and a vibrant lifestyle.
The 8-10 week hybrid bootcamp stands out for combining cloud-based learning with in-person collaboration, emphasizing JavaScript and Ruby development through team-driven, project-based assignments.
The school's educational philosophy is rooted in the Cooperative Learning Institute's four pillars - individual accountability, promotive interaction, social skills, and group processing - fostering strong teamwork and real-world problem solving.
With a stellar student-to-instructor ratio of three instructors for every ten students, participants benefit from personalized guidance and six months of post-program mentorship to keep momentum going on projects and skill development.
Accommodation and co-working space memberships are included, minimizing daily distractions like commuting and letting students focus on building their portfolios in a relaxed, supportive tropical setting.
According to the detailed review at Bootcamps.in Ruby On The Beach Review, this immersive approach not only equips graduates for junior developer roles but also helps them build valuable industry connections through an active alumni network.
As highlighted by Career Karma's Ruby On The Beach Bootcamp Roundup, flexible payment options, including upfront and loan financing, are available for students.

Le Wagon: High-Energy, Outcomes-Focused Bootcamp with Global Reach
(Up)Le Wagon's Bali campus stands out as Indonesia's premier choice for those seeking a vibrant, outcomes-focused bootcamp experience in web development, data analytics, and data science.
Classes are available both on campus and online, with schedules ranging from immersive nine-week full-time programs to flexible part-time options, accommodating students from various backgrounds and age ranges (Coding Bootcamp in Bali, Indonesia).
Renowned globally as the #1 ranked tech bootcamp with an impressive 4.98/5 rating from over 6,000 reviews, Le Wagon offers hands-on training, a supportive community, and tailored learning paths - enabling graduates to secure tech roles on average within three months of finishing the program (Data Science & AI course in Bali, Indonesia).
According to the official FAQ:
“We've had students over 50 who succeeded in learning Web Development or Data and starting new careers like anyone else. Age is not a factor; commitment and motivation are what matter.”
In Bali, students benefit from daily face-to-face collaboration, teacher support, and access to a global network of hiring partners, with opportunities spanning full stack development, data analysis, and entrepreneurship.
The bootcamp's inclusivity - welcoming both beginners and career changers - and flexible financing options are highlighted in its extensive FAQ, ensuring a transparent path for Indonesians aiming to break into tech (Le Wagon FAQ).
